Despite myriad bundle deals for Xbox One S and PlayStation PS4, there were no 'meaningful hardware sellouts' from Nov. 29 to Dec. 2
Did a Black Friday to Cyber Monday digital video game frenzy help tamp down sales of an aging generation of consoles? Despite myriad bundle deals for Xbox One S and PlayStation PS4 , there were no "meaningful hardware sellouts" from Nov. 29 to Dec. 2, per Wedbush Securities.
The figure represents a 9 percent bump year-over-year.
